Trump's Oval Office Redesign: Gold Accents and Political Messaging

President Trump's Oval Office redesign includes numerous gold accents, additional portraits (including President Polk), a copy of the Declaration of Independence, and the removal of a long-standing ivy plant, reflecting his personal brand and political messaging.

Madrid's Storm Tanks Prevent Flooding Amidst Heavy Rainfall

Heavy rainfall in Madrid has swollen rivers, but 1.42 billion liters of rainwater are stored in underground storm tanks, preventing flooding and protecting rivers from pollution; the region plans to build 100 more.

Horse Trek Across Ligurian Alps Creates First Official Trail

A British man rode a horse 2,000 miles from Siena, Italy to Finisterre, Spain, unexpectedly creating the first official horse trail across the Ligurian Alps in the process, aided by locals and a fellow traveler, ultimately leading him to found a charity based on his experiences.

East German Representation in Thuringian Ministerial Leadership

February data from the Thuringian State Chancellery reveals that 49.4% of leadership positions in Thuringian ministries are held by East Germans, with significant variations across ministries and leadership levels, prompting discussions about diversity and inclusion.

Georgia Approves $300 Million in Tax Breaks for Hurricane Helene Relief

Georgia lawmakers approved almost $300 million in tax breaks for farmers and timber owners harmed by Hurricane Helene, including tax exemptions on federal aid and credits for replanting trees, supplementing earlier disaster relief allocations.

Mecklenburg-Vorpommern Addresses Surge in Violent Crime with Enhanced Victim Support

Mecklenburg-Vorpommern's 2023 crime statistics reveal 25,000 victims of violence and threats, including 1,350 sexual offenses and 8,400 crimes against personal freedom, prompting calls for enhanced victim support services.

Greek Opposition Parties Face Decline Amidst 'Plefsi Eleftherias''s Rise

Recent polls show PASOK and SYRIZA experiencing significant declines, while 'Plefsi Eleftherias' gains ground, leading to internal criticism within PASOK and strategic adjustments within SYRIZA regarding the political agenda.
